Before Adventure Time became a sprawling mythos about existential dread, broken families, and the cyclical nature of the universe, it was something simpler: a weird, loud, and hilarious D&D campaign on a sugar rush. Season 1 (originally airing in 2010) is a unique artifact. It is raw. The animation is looser, Finn’s voice (voiced by Zack Shada before Jeremy Shada took over fully) is slightly different, and the Land of Ooo feels genuinely dangerous and unpredictable.
